The look from TV chef Gordon Ramsay said it all. When Jade Goody, interviewed before she started yesterday's London marathon, said she'd done little training and hadn't swapped her curries for carbo-fuelled bowls of pasta, you didn't need to be a genius to know what Ramsay was thinking - it's going to hurt and it's going to hurt bad, writes London marathon veteran Liz Ford.

In the end it did a little more than that. Goody, the Big Brother "star" who has made a subsequent living from appearances in Heat magazine and, ironically, releasing fitness videos, collapsed in exhaustion 18 miles into the course. It was on a stretch along the Isle of Dogs that is notoriously difficult for all runners (even Paula Radcliffe admitting to feeling a little rough at this stage on her world record-breaking win). It's a time when those months of training on cold, wet evenings kick in and you start guzzling Lucozade drinks and sucking on energy sweets like there's going to be a shortage.

It appears that Goody made the rookie mistake of believing the crowds alone are enough to get you around the 26.2-mile course.
